This subcontract is for the bulk supply of membrane grade 32% sodium hydroxide, also known as caustic soda, to support the City of Greenville, Texas. The estimated annual requirement is 150 dry tons, which equates to approximately 50,000 to 70,000 gallons. Deliveries are to be made as needed via tank truck to designated sites within the city. The procurement process is managed by the Texas Procurement agency under NAICS code 424720. The solicitation was posted on August 3, 2026, with a response deadline of August 18, 2026.
